Packaging and packaging wastefiled 3 Aug 2020source

Assobioplastiche is the Italian association representing the bio-based, biodegradable and compostable plastics sector. The following feedback is related to the study “Effectiveness of the Essential Requirements for Packaging and Packaging Waste and Proposals for Reinforcement” commissioned by the European Commission to Eunomia and published in April 2020.
